Chamathka’s career is defined by several standout moments that showcase her range as a dramatic actress. The Breakout in "Husma" (2019)
One of her most discussed "movie moments" comes from her lead role in Husma. Playing Tharuka Wijesinghe, Chamathka delivered a challenging performance in this intense psychological thriller. The film, which centers on a group of men who break into a morgue, required her to portray a character in a state of suspended animation, a role that was both physically and emotionally demanding. This performance is often cited by fans as her most daring work to date. Award-Winning Performance in "Watch Hours"
At the NSBM Youth Film Festival 2023, Chamathka received a Special Award for Inter-University Best Actress for her work in the film Watch Hours. This recognition solidified her status as one of the most promising young talents in the local industry, highlighting her ability to lead student-led and independent productions with professional depth. Chamathka Lakmini has quickly established herself as a significant talent in modern Sinhala cinema. Known for her ability to handle dark, complex themes with emotional transparency, her filmography reflects a move from traditional roles toward gritty, character-driven storytelling. Filmography Highlights
Husma (2019): This psychological drama-thriller is widely considered her breakout performance. As a remake of the Spanish film The Corpse of Anna Fritz, it demanded a high level of physical and emotional stillness from Lakmini, who portrayed the central character, Tharuka Wijesinghe.
Sarungal (2018): One of her earlier appearances, where she played Asanki, showcasing her range in more conventional dramatic structures before her pivot to darker genres. video title chamathka lakmini hot sex scene in hot
Ethalaya (2020): A role that solidified her presence in the industry following the success of Husma.
Piyambanna Ayeth (2022): Playing Sadisha, Lakmini continued to diversify her portfolio in this contemporary drama.
Varna (2024): Her most recent major credit, featuring her as Anuradha, signaling her continued relevance as a leading actress in the mid-2020s. Notable Movie Moments
The Surreal Silence of Husma: The film's most haunting moments center on Lakmini’s performance in the morgue. Her ability to convey vulnerability and terror with minimal dialogue became a hallmark of her acting style.
Visual Nuance in Varna: Reviews of her 2024 work highlight her growth in using visual storytelling, where her "luminosity as a star" and emotional transparency carry scenes that explore socially relevant and dark themes.
Digital and Social Presence: Beyond feature films, her "Notable Movie Moments" extend to high-production music videos like Andakaraye (2024) and web series like A.Y.V. on CeyFlix, where she collaborates with acclaimed actors like Kalana Gunasekara. Critical Verdict
Chamathka Lakmini is a "fearless" performer. While her career began in the late 2010s, her willingness to take on "risky" projects like Husma sets her apart from her peers. She is a vital part of the new wave of Sri Lankan actors who prioritize atmospheric and psychological depth over traditional commercial tropes. Chamathka Lakmini (@chamathka.live) • Facebook

Chamathka Lakmini is a rising Sri Lankan actress who gained significant attention for her bold performance in the 2019 drama-thriller movie Husma. Known for taking on challenging roles, she recently won the award for Best Upcoming Actress at the 2024 Sarasaviya Awards for her work in the film. Career and Notable Roles
Husma (2019): Lakmini played the character Tharuka Wijesinghe in this film, which centers around a tense situation in a mortuary. Her performance was widely discussed for its raw and daring nature.
Recent Filmography: She has appeared in several recent productions, including Ethalaya (2020), Piyambanna Ayeth (2022), and Varna (2024). Review Criteria:
Television & Web Series: Lakmini has ventured into digital content, notably appearing in the CeyFlix Mini Web Series titled A.Y.V. alongside Kalana Gunasekara. Perspective on Bold Scenes
Chamathka Lakmini has been open about her choice to perform in provocative or "bold" scenes, emphasizing that she chooses roles based on their artistic merit rather than seeking controversy. In interviews, she has addressed the public's reaction to her scenes in Husma, stating that she is not "bankrupt" enough to take on just any role and that she stands by her professional choices.
